Job Summary

The User Experience/User Interface (UX/UI) Designer - Digital plays a key role in supporting the creation of user-centered digital experiences by collaborating with cross-functional teams to develop and refine design solutions. This role assists in crafting intuitive, engaging, and accessible interfaces that align with business objectives and user needs. By participating in usability testing, research, and iterative design processes, the UX/UI Designer - Digital helps ensure seamless interactions across digital platforms.

Who You Are

Minimum Candidate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or's degree in design, human-centered design (HCD), or a related field.

  • 3 years in UX/UI design, with expertise in user-centered design and creating intuitive, visually engaging interfaces.

  • Proficiency in design tools like Adobe XD, Sketch, Figma, or similar.

  • Strong understanding of accessibility standards, design systems, and UX best practices.

  • Experience translating user needs into detailed wireframes, prototypes, and high-fidelity mockups.

  • Proven ability to collaborate with cross-functional teams and integrate feedback into design solutions.
